Default New LS460 is in the showroom now...

We received our first 2013 LS460 last Wednesday. The first one has the Shimamoku wood steering wheel, Mark Levinson, 19" graphite polished wheels, semi aniline leather and alcantara head liner. It has an MSRP around $82,000.

There are quite a few variations possible depending on your region's preferences. Here in the East we get all wheel drive mostly. This car will be very stable in the freezing rain that we get in the Winter.

I went for a few drives with the staff this morning and with the conventional suspension the new LS kept its composure in the corners. Everyone liked the beauty of the Shimamoku steering wheel when the sunlight reflected off the layers like the retina in a cat's green eyes.

One of the cool things to try is the clock setting in general setup. When you turn off daylight savings time the minutes hand does a quick lap around the dial and abruptly stops at the new time. Another crowd pleaser is the temperature display that rolls the numbers like a retro digital clock...

Default Tire position check...

You can tell which tire by a little overview of the car and the pressure readout next to each position including the spare.

I have only used one Tom Tom which was not bad except if you wanted some special features it required a bit of hunting through the menu. The Lexus navigation system has a lot of new voice commands which can be used while moving to access a live operator to download your destination while you just concentrate on driving. If you take a test drive push the talk switch on the right side of the steering wheel and say "Destination" then follow that with "call destination assist. Every time you use this feature you are creating American jobs....

Not every part of the country observes daylight savings time and it will vary what date the change takes place so you just need to touch the menu button, select setup with the controller, general and time is the first setting. If you were to drive between time zones it does advance or retard the time the same way by a lap around the dial automatically.

There are over 3,000 changes in the new design and you shouldn't have to drive far to notice the difference....

The Auto door closers are listed in standard equipment on our first AWD standard wheelbase.

The advanced per collision is pretty cool and it will intervene if it detects something in your path like a pedestrian if you are traveling at 25 MPH or less. We found it still worked slightly above 30 MPH. It also utilizes a driver attention monitor. We have this feature on a 2013 GS450h but I haven't found a good way to demo or test it other than a scan tool.

I was alerted by Toyota this morning that the new analog clock will not automatically reset when crossing time zones so I was wrong in my interpretation of this feature. Mea Culpa...
